#84f1c2 basic color information

#84f1c2

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#84f1c2 has decimal index of: 8712642, is composed of 51.8% red, 94.5% green and 76.1% blue. #84f1c2 in CMYK color model, is composed of 45.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.5% yellow and 5.5% black.
#99ffcc is the closest web-safe color to #84f1c2.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
